Another innocent Bawm citizen dies in Chittagong jail

Hill Voice, 17 July 2025, Special Correspondent: Today (17 July) at around 10:30 AM, another innocent Bawm citizen from Bandarban reportedly died of a stroke while in custody at Chittagong Central Jail.

The deceased was identified as Vanlal Rual Bawm (35), son of Rouphir Bawm, a resident of Ronin Para village in Bandarban. So far, three innocent Bawm villagers, falsely accused and detained without trial, have died in prison.

Earlier, on 15 May 2025, another Bawm detainee named Laltleng Kim Bawm (30) died in Chittagong Central Jail due to a lack of proper medical treatment. Subsequently, another Bawm individual, Sangmoy Bawm (55), who had also been seriously ill, passed away on 1 June 2025, just one day after being granted bail. All three had been held for over a year without trial, and despite the deterioration of their health, they were denied appropriate medical care.

It is worth mentioning that Vanlal Rual Bawm was arrested by the army in 2023 on false charge of being a member of the KNF, also known as the Bawm Party—a group once created by the military and later known for sheltering and training terrorist and Islamist militant organizations.

Following a bank robbery carried out by Kuki-Chin National Front (KNF) terrorists on 2 April 2024, a joint anti-KNF operation led by the Bangladesh Army began on 8 April 2024. During the operation, nearly 150 members of the Bawm community—including men, women, and children—were arrested. Reports indicate that, apart from a few actual KNF members, the majority of those detained were innocent villagers.
